LogoBETABeta
Amy Poehler, Dr. Ruth Westheimer

Late Night with Seth Meyers

Season 6Episode 100Aired 2019-05-10
Amy Poehler, Dr. Ruth Westheimer

Amy Poehler, Dr. Ruth Westheimer

Actress Amy Poehler; sex therapist Dr. Ruth Westheimer; Philip “Fish” Fisher sits in with the 8G Band.